As Formerly stated, DCS can encompass quite a few control modules that function independently and concurrently; On top of that, it's speedy conversation functionality involving its modules through conversation strains with the data highway in actual-time.

The controller command is transmitted to your controlled course of action by the final factor. In industrial processes, valves are usually employed as ultimate factors.

Relocating the final aspect, for instance opening and shutting a valve, demands Strength use. The command sent with the controller is often a control sign that typically doesn't have the expected energy to move the final aspect.

A DCS ordinarily utilizes custom made-built processors as controllers and employs possibly proprietary interconnections or standard protocols for conversation. Enter and output modules form the peripheral components on the system.

Moreover, they accept designs designed in analytical tools for example MATLAB and Simulink. Unlike standard PLCs, which use proprietary operating systems, IPCs use Home windows IoT. IPCs have the advantage of highly effective multi-Main processors with Significantly reduced hardware prices than classic PLCs and fit effectively into several variety variables such as DIN rail mount, combined with a contact-display screen to be a panel PC, or being an embedded Personal computer. SCADA's background is rooted in distribution purposes, for instance electric power, pure gas, and h2o pipelines, in which there is a require to gather distant knowledge by means of perhaps unreliable or intermittent small-bandwidth and high-latency one-way links. SCADA systems use open-loop control with web-sites which are greatly separated geographically.

The distributed control program, or DCS, entered the process control arena within the nineteen sixties and complemented DDC systems. A distributed control technique is amongst the different types of control systems by which Procedure is distributed instead of staying concentrated at one issue.
